Ranking of Nebraska Counties By Population with Dutch West Indian Ancestry in 2021

Updated on April 16, 2025.

Based on the US Census ACS-5Yrs estimates, in 2021, there were 92 people in Nebraska with Dutch West Indian ancestry. Among all Nebraska counties, Douglas County had the highest population with Dutch West Indian ancestry (30), followed by York County (18), and Lancaster County (16).

Ranking of Nebraska Counties By Population with Dutch West Indian Ancestry in 2021
0 of 0
Rank County Population
1 Douglas County 30
2 York County 18
3 Lancaster County 16
4 Cass County 12
5 Burt County 9
6 Wayne County 6
7 Kearney County 1
